Hi there I am currently doing a clean myself 4 years after discharge. I found that with most off them I could get it sorted over the phone, and they changed the records. once you find the right dept in the company (usually the collections dept or something like that) They know that defaulting you is wrong and if you read the sticky on this forum regarding credit file clean up then you will have all the info you need, which scares them cause you know what your talking about, and the poor call operator on the other end usually doesn’t.
Read the sticky post first then call the companies (and don’t forget to use saynoto0870.com which will save you a fortune in call fees). if you have no joy with the calls then unfortunately you need to send a letter (there is a template in the sticky post on this forum) and wait 28 days if there still not changed then you need to send them another letter to inform them that they are in breech of certain regulations, I haven’t got that far myself yet so don’t want to advise you in something I haven’t really came across yet.
But anyway try the calls and hopefully that will work
